Res delete or no?
I have the top speed pro 1 muffler and I absolutely love it. However, I would like a little bit more sound from it. I think. I am not sure whether I do or not. Should I delete the res? would this make it just obnoxiously loud? or would it sound a bit more aggressive on start up and WOT?
I am nervous to do it as I might not like it, and then its money down the drain... thoughts?

Don't delete them. Get magnaflow high flow cats instead. Do a search there are threads. A bumper sticker will void your warranty if your specific dealer says so. Go to the region sections and find out who the mod friendly dealers are. In Atlanta United BMW Roswell and BMW of South Atlanta are 100% mod friendly, where other dealers will freak at anything. Primary cat deletes gives you real gains. Also I don't recommend running a muffler delete with cat deletes, considerate loss of pressure. Plus you really need a dyno tune to take advantage of the cat delete. |
